West Nile Virus Found In Allegan County Crow

allegancountylogo

The Allegan County Health Department says a wild crow found dead in an Otsego yard has tested positive for West Nile virus. The Michigan Department of Health and Human Services informed the health department of the crow’s virus. No human cases of West Nile virus have been found in Allegan County yet this fall.

To protect yourself from the virus, officials urge wearing long-sleeve shirts and long pants, using insect repellant with DEET, and maintain window and door screens to keep mosquitoes outside. Other steps are to keep old tires, buckets, kiddie pools and more free from water and using nets or fans over outdoor eating areas. Mosquitoes remain active until the first hard frost of the year.
